Job Description:
Position Overview:We seek a dynamic leader to refine the
management of Operating Unit (OU) Directors within Global Marketing
Procurement (GMP), ensuring alignment and tangible productivity
across OUs. The Senior Director will lead a team of 6 OU Directors
(OUDs), who drive strategic sourcing initiatives and align with GMP
productivity plans. This role balances leading an OU and managing
other Directors, ensuring OU needs are met during multi-OU
negotiations while leveraging scale. The goal is for OUDs to
collaborate effectively with Towers and local businesses to secure
'fit for purpose' agencies and services, ensuring excellent
negotiations, contract management, responsible sourcing, and
maximizing ROI. Reporting to the VP Global Marketing Procurement,
the candidate will share responsibility for $6bn in marketing spend
and be a key partner within the marketing community.Please note:
This is not a remote role and will require the incumbent to be
based in either Atlanta, London or Dublin and follow a hybrid work
schedule. This is a People Leader role.What You'll Do for Us:
- Lead a team of 6 OUDs to manage negotiations, contracts and
performance of agencies and suppliers on an OU basis alongside OU
focused Tower teams. Manage and align GMP behind productivity
projects and targets.
- Lead and participate in cross-functional teams, including
Frontline teams, bottlers, legal, OU marketing, and Finance, to
ensure business fundamentals are reflected in final agreements.
Manage a large and varied portfolio of activities and projects,
leading a team autonomously through complex service delivery
stages.
- Ensure thorough approval and analysis documentation according
to policy, consolidate deal terms for senior management
presentations, and coach the team to become best-in-class
negotiation and deal delivery partners. Develop and implement
innovative sourcing approaches using analytics to assess scenarios,
benefits, risks, and change management impacts.
- Maintain strong relationships with senior management across
TCCC and bottlers. Achieve alignment with stakeholders to reach
mutually beneficial outcomes, develop effective remuneration & ROI
models, and ensure maximum value from partnerships.
- Provide expertise to leverage spend, increase value, and
decrease total costs. Analyze industry trends, evolving technology,
and supplier competencies to minimize risks, protect supply
continuity, and exploit opportunities beneficial to TCCC.
- Build a central best practice information suite, benchmarking,
and cost modeling approach while supporting continuous learning.
Leverage total spend across all OUs, developing a global
partnership approach for competitive positioning.
- Identify, classify, maintain, and protect files and sensitive
information per record handling and retention requirements. Meet
company targets on savings, cash flow, sustainability, and people
performance.Qualifications & Requirements:
